Central Texas Clean Cities is a nonprofit organization focused on education and environmental advocacy in Central Texas. With an operating budget of $118.7K and total revenue of $119.1K for the 2024 filing year, the organization aims to advance the region's environment, energy security, and economic prosperity by fostering partnerships with public and private stakeholders to promote equitable clean transportation solutions. The organization does not rely on a single funder for 50% or more of its revenue. For more information, visit their website at ctxcleancities.org.

Mission Statement
To advance Central Texas's environment, energy security, and economic prosperity through collaboration with communities by building partnerships with public and private stakeholders to create equitable deployment of clean transportation solutions for all.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Central Texas Clean Cities’s budget?
In 2024, Central Texas Clean Cities reported an annual operating budget of around $119 thousand.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
What causes does Central Texas Clean Cities support?
Central Texas Clean Cities supports work in Education.
Where does Central Texas Clean Cities operate?
Central Texas Clean Cities is headquartered in Austin, TX.
What is Central Texas Clean Cities’s reliance on government grants?
Central Texas Clean Cities relied on government grants for more than 90% of their total revenue in 2024.
